west indian snowberry

Noun west indian snowberry has 1 sense
  1. blolly, West Indian snowberry, Chiococca alba - evergreen climbing shrub of southern Florida and West Indies grown for its racemes of fragrant white to creamy flowers followed by globose white succulent berries
    --1 is a kind of shrub, bush
    --1 is a member of Chiococca, genus Chiococca
